**Ticket ORM-482: Legacy ORM refactor causes duplicate row hydration**

During the Quellbase ORM refactor, entity caching now returns stale duplicates. Repro: 1) Open the Marnick admin console. 2) Load any customer record twice within five seconds. 3) Observe two hydrated copies in the debug panel. Affects version 3.2 onward. Support should escalate any customer reports referencing "duplicate profiles" to the platform team. To query the staging replica directly, authenticate with the token below.

session JWT of yawep-yawep = eyJhbGciOiJIUzI1NiIsInR5cCI6IkpXVCJ9.eyJzdWIiOiI3pWF3_In0.aXYsHiog

Subject: Pagination cut-over complete

Team — the Brindlewick public API is now fully on cursor-based pagination. Offset parameters are accepted but ignored as of last night's deploy; clients on the old scheme get the first page plus a deprecation header. Error rates are flat and p95 latency dropped slightly. If you get paged, the relevant knobs are the page-size caps and cursor TTLs listed below.

service settings:
[casax]
port = 6379
team = rusir
host = casax.zemvarhq.corp
region = outer-4
access_code = ac_9808ce
timeout_ms = 1500

This note covers the second-source supplier search for the Aldermere sensor housings. Three candidates remain: Brayfield Castings, Ossett Precision, and Velmor Works. Brayfield has cleared the initial audit; Ossett's samples failed tolerance twice; Velmor's quote is pending. Qualification files sit with the quality office, and the scoring matrix is current through last week. Please continue weekly check-ins with procurement. The confidential commercial context is appended below.

board note of bafog-taduf: Gross margin on Oliath came in at 5 percent against a plan of 5 percent. Only 9 of the 120 pilot accounts renewed Oliath, so a churn review is set for January 15.

- [ ] Key ceremony step 7: Rotate the signing key for Bucketeer, our A/B experiment assignment service. New joiners: confirm both witnesses are present before unsealing, verify the hardware token serial against the ceremony log, and read each command aloud before executing. Do not skip the dry-run on the staging shard — assignment hashes must stay stable or every running experiment rebuckets. Once both witnesses have initialed the log, record the recovery passphrase exactly as shown below.

unlock words, kawig-bawef: belax-sorir-druax-ulaiel-wenael-belael